More About Air Gestures In Your Samsung Galaxy S4 :
Before showing you how to activate these Air Gestures on your Samsung Galaxy S4, it is important for you to know how actually do these actions work.
And don’t worry, it is no mystery. All gesture-based actions are covered with the help of sensors connected to the front-facing camera of your Samsung Galaxy S4.
Therefore your gesture actions should be done parallel to the camera for your actions to be recorded.
You can do the following functions with the help of Air Gestures :
- Make or end calls: You can make or end calls by simply waving your hand parallel to the front-facing camera.
- Swipe Through Gallery, Webpages, Music Player, etc. : You can use gestures to navigate back and forth on the music player, browser, gallery, s memo, etc.
- Air Move: You can move the widgets throughout all your home screens by holding the desired widget and waving your hand to change home screen.
These are some of the major uses based on gestures on the Samsung Galaxy S4. Other features of the Samsung Galaxy S4 include Samsung Smart Scroll, Smart Pause, etc.
How To Enable Galaxy S4’s Air Gesture :
Below is how you can enable air gestures on your Samsung Galaxy S4 :
- From your device’s app drawer, go to Settings.
- Then navigate to My Device located at the top right.
- From the options that appear, navigate and click on Motion and Gestures.
- Under Motion and Gestures, you can find 3 different gestural functions.
- You can switch ON each gestural function separately according to your choice.
- Once you turn ON any gestural function, you will see an animated demo demonstrating the function.
Know Why Air Gestures Are Not Working On Your Samsung Galaxy S4 :
Lately, many people including my friends have bought the Samsung Galaxy S4, and most of them complain that the gestural features do not work on their device.
On my testing with a Samsung Galaxy S4, I found out some possible reasons why gestural actions are not working on your device :
- The sensors for the Air Gesture Technology are located close to the front-facing camera. Hence if you wave your hands by covering the front facing camera, then your gestures probably won’t get noticed. Also, make sure your gestures are made parallel to the front-facing camera.
- As I said, each gestural setting has separate ON/OFF toggle. Hence, if one of your preferred gesture is not working, make sure that it is toggled ON under Motion and Gestures in the settings menu.
- In some rare cases, screen protectors or even protective cases can block the vision of the sensors. Hence these sensors won’t be able to capture your gestures.
- Make sure you don’t wave your hands too fast, also keep only a minimum distance between the device and your palm while waving. I have noticed people waving very fast at these sensors or even waving from a bit far away distance.
- If you find none of these tips working, simply try restarting your device then toggling your gestures back to ON from settings. Even if that doesn’t help, then take your device to your dealer or service center for help and get it fixed.
